Snow Removal Long Island, New York
If you stay in Long Island Nassau County or somewhere else in New York, you know the weather is far from predictable. While the situation is relatively unpredictable, one thing is sure. That is, Long Island and other areas in New York are no strangers to heavy snowfall. Before the 2019/2020 season, we had two quite low snowfall seasons. 2018/2019, all we had was 15.1 inches of snow cover. While many expected the same in 2019/2020, things changed. By the middle of February, we had seen more than 27 inches of snow. This is amazing considering we had no snow in February the previous winter season.
As of now, many meteorologists say we might have a colder winter in the 2020/2021 season. We are expecting precipitation and snowfall a little bit above normal. Following the records that should be about 30 to 50 inches of snow cover.

Snow Removal FAQs in Long Island, NY
Shoveling and snow blowing are usually included in a snow removal service. For small places, this option may be a more cost-effective alternative to plow service. Professional snow removal might cost $50-100 per hour, depending on where you reside.
Clearing snow and ice from the sidewalk in front of your house or public places can assist you to prevent slipping and falling.
Shovelling snow without caution can put individuals of all ages at risk. However, persons over the age of 55 are more likely to suffer a heart attack when shovelling snow. It’s advisable to avoid shovelling snow oneself if you’re a senior citizen, especially if you have a heart condition.
Sand is used to providing traction on ice roadways since it is an abrasive material. It can provide grip on the ice at any temperature, but rock salt is ineffective in extremely cold temperatures. Sand, on the other hand, is only effective if it is on the ice’s surface. It must be reapplied if it is covered by snow.
The city does not clear or remove snow or ice from sidewalks in front of homes and workplaces. Any bus stop or fire hydrant in front of your house must also be shovelled. You are not permitted to shovel snow into the street. If the snow stops falling between:
– 7 am and 5 pm, you must clear sidewalks within 4 hours
– 5 pm and 9 pm, you must clear sidewalks within 14 hours
– 9 pm and 5 pm, you must clear sidewalks by 11 am The city does not clear or remove snow or ice from sidewalks in front of homes and workplaces.
